Latest Patents
Goh's latest patents include "Efficient Resource Allocation for Service Level Compliance" and "Scalable Attestation for Trusted Execution Environments." The first patent focuses on various approaches to efficiently allocating and utilizing hardware resources in data centers while maintaining compliance with a specified service level objective (SLO). This innovation translates the SLO into a hardware-level SLO, facilitating direct enforcement by the hardware processor. It employs a feedback control loop or model-based mapping to optimize microarchitecture resource allocations. Additionally, it utilizes a computational model to predict application performance under resource contention scenarios, allowing for effective scheduling of workloads within data centers.
The second patent addresses function-as-a-service (FaaS) environments, where clients utilize functions executing within a trusted execution environment (TEE) on a FaaS server. This innovation allows multiple tenants to provide functions executed by the FaaS platform via a gateway. Each tenant can offer code and data for various functions within TEEs, establishing trust through a surrogate attester TEE. This ensures that client devices have confidence in the integrity of the functions being executed.
